Transaction 50131c54a8186e71e001caf1987c5346ffa30f679581679dfb7ae5e0e7bb7e7c
1 Input
1 Output
-
50131c54a8186e71e001caf1987c5346ffa30f679581679dfb7ae5e0e7bb7e7c:0
- value
- 48298
- script pubkey
- OP_0 OP_PUSHBYTES_20 39a864a759e6ad05dbfe64f478c0633d6e1c4280
- address
- bc1q8x5xff6eu6kstkl7vn683srr84hpcs5qywk5hx